Spence, Leisure Services Mana SUBJECT: Five Flags HVAC and Promenade Roof Replacement Project #1514 and #1885 INTRODUCTION The purpose of this memorandum is to request that the City Council initiate the bidding process for the Five Flags HVAC and Promenade Roof Replacement Project. DISCUSSION This project provides for the final phase of the HVAC replacement project (two roof top units were not included as they will not need to be replaced until FY 2014) and replacement of the promenade roof. The engineer's estimate for the project is $670, 000. The schedule for the project is as follows: City Council initiate bidding process Notice to bidders Notice of public hearing Pre-bid construction meeting Public hearing Receipt of bids Award contract Project completion date November 5, 2007 November 9, 2007 November 9, 2007 November 14, 2007 November 19, 2007 December 6, 2007 December 17, 2007 June 6, 2008 The FY 2008 C.I.P. budget contains $600,000 for the HVAC replacement and $70,000 for the promenade roof replacement. Total project estimates are as follows: Construction contract $ 680,000 Design fees 65,000 Total $ 745,000 Five Flags HVAC and promenade roof replacement page two This base bid is $75,000 over budget but I recommend we proceed with the bidding. This is the minimum work needed and funds from the theater stage lift project will be moved to this project, if needed. The budget for the roof replacement is $70,000 and the cost estimate is $185,000. The engineer believes that our budget price was to recover the roof. His estimate is based on removal of two previous roof systems; the code does not allow for adding a third layer and replacing with a new layer. Two alternates are also being bid: one is for replacement of the hot water boiler and hot water heater ($175,000) and the other is the condensing unit in the theater ($43,000). ACTION STEP The action requested is that the City Council adopt the attached resolutions giving preliminary approval of plans and specifications, ordering bids, and setting the date of public hearing.
